From a770206c91e495b802b3e9371e06834586ad7715 Mon Sep 17 00:00:00 2001
From: dengjunjie <dengjunjie@hnkhzn.com>
Date: 星期四, 30 十月 2025 20:17:30 +0800
Subject: [PATCH] 1
---
新建文件夹/WMS/src/views/basic/locationInfo.vue | 258 ++++++++++++++++++++++++++++++++++++++-------------
1 files changed, 192 insertions(+), 66 deletions(-)
diff --git "a/\346\226\260\345\273\272\346\226\207\344\273\266\345\244\271/WMS/src/views/basic/locationInfo.vue" "b/\346\226\260\345\273\272\346\226\207\344\273\266\345\244\271/WMS/src/views/basic/locationInfo.vue"
index 298e017..3e717b4 100644
--- "a/\346\226\260\345\273\272\346\226\207\344\273\266\345\244\271/WMS/src/views/basic/locationInfo.vue"
+++ "b/\346\226\260\345\273\272\346\226\207\344\273\266\345\244\271/WMS/src/views/basic/locationInfo.vue"
@@ -1,4 +1,3 @@
-
<template>
<view-grid
ref="grid"
@@ -13,7 +12,7 @@
>
</view-grid>
</template>
- <script>
+<script>
import extend from "@/extension/basic/locationInfo.js";
import { ref, defineComponent } from "vue";
export default defineComponent({
@@ -27,140 +26,277 @@
sortName: "id",
});
const editFormFields = ref({
- locationStatus: "",
- });
- const editFormOptions = ref([
- [
- { title: "璐т綅鐘舵��", field: "locationStatus" ,type: "select",dataKey: "locationStatusEnum",data: [],},
- ],
- ]);
- const searchFormFields = ref({
+ warehouseId: "",
locationCode: "",
+ locationName: "",
roadwayNo: "",
- locationType: "",
- enableStatus: "",
- locationStatus: "",
row: "",
column: "",
layer: "",
+ depth: "",
+ locationType: "",
+ locationStatus: "",
+ enableStatus: "",
+ remark: "",
+ warehouseCode:"",
+ });
+ const editFormOptions = ref([
+ [
+ // {
+ // field: "warehouseId",
+ // title: "搴撴埧缂栧彿",
+ // type: "select",
+ // required: true,
+ // span: 12,
+ // dataKey: "warehouseNuber",
+ // data: []
+ // },
+ {
+ field: "warehouseCode",
+ title: "搴撴埧缂栧彿",
+ type: "select",
+ required: true,
+ span: 12,
+ dataKey: "warehouseNuber",
+ data: []
+ },
+
+ {
+ field: "locationCode",
+ title: "璐т綅缂栧彿",
+ type: "string",
+ span: 12
+ }
+ ],
+ [
+ {
+ field: "locationName",
+ title: "璐т綅鍚嶇О",
+ type: "string",
+ span: 12
+ },
+ {
+ field: "roadwayNo",
+ title: "宸烽亾缂栧彿",
+ type: "string",
+ span: 12
+ }
+ ],
+ [
+ {
+ field: "row",
+ title: "璐т綅琛�",
+ type: "int",
+ span: 8
+ },
+ {
+ field: "column",
+ title: "璐т綅鍒�",
+ type: "int",
+ span: 8
+ },
+
+ ],
+ [
+ {
+ field: "depth",
+ title: "璐т綅娣卞害",
+ type: "int",
+ span: 12
+ },
+ // {
+ // field: "locationType",
+ // title: "璐т綅绫诲瀷",
+ // type: "select",
+ // span: 12,
+ // data: [],
+ // dataKey: "locationTypeEnum",
+ // }
+ {
+ field: "layer",
+ title: "璐т綅灞�",
+ type: "int",
+ span: 8
+ }
+ ],
+ [
+ {
+ field: "locationStatus",
+ title: "璐т綅鐘舵��",
+ type: "select",
+ span: 12,
+ data: [],
+ dataKey: "locationStatusEnum",
+ },
+ {
+ field: "enableStatus",
+ title: "绂佺敤鐘舵��",
+ type: "select",
+ span: 12,
+ dataKey:"EnableStatusEnum",
+ data: [],
+ }
+ ],
+ // [
+ // {
+ // field: "remark",
+ // title: "澶囨敞",
+ // type: "string",
+ // span: 24
+ // }
+ // ]
+ ]);
+ const searchFormFields = ref({
+ // warehouseId: "",
+ locationCode: "",
+ locationName: "",
+ roadwayNo: "",
+ locationType: "",
+ locationStatus: "",
+ enableStatus: "",
+ row: "",
+ column: "",
+ layer: "",
+ warehouseCode: ""
});
const searchFormOptions = ref([
[
+ // { title: "搴撴埧缂栧彿", field: "warehouseId", type: "select", dataKey: "warehouseNuber", data: [] } ,
+ { title: "搴撴埧缂栧彿", field: "warehousecode", type: "select", dataKey: "warehouseNuber", data: [] } ,
{ title: "璐т綅缂栧彿", field: "locationCode", type: "like" },
- { title: "宸烽亾缂栧彿", field: "roadwayNo",type:"like" },
- { title: "璐т綅绫诲瀷", field: "locationType",type: "select",dataKey: "locationTypeEnum",data: [], },
- { title: "绂佺敤鐘舵��", field: "enableStatus" ,type: "select",dataKey: "status",data: [],},
+ { title: "璐т綅鍚嶇О", field: "locationName", type: "like" },
],
[
- { title: "璐т綅鐘舵��", field: "locationStatus" ,type: "selectList",dataKey: "locationStatusEnum",data: [],},
- { title: "琛�", field: "row" ,type: "int"},
- { title: "鍒�", field: "column" ,type: "int"},
- { title: "灞�", field: "layer" ,type: "int"}
+ { title: "宸烽亾缂栧彿", field: "roadwayNo", type: "like" },
+ // { title: "璐т綅绫诲瀷", field: "locationType", type: "select", dataKey: "locationTypeEnum", data: [] },
+ { title: "璐т綅鐘舵��", field: "locationStatus", type: "select", dataKey: "locationStatusEnum",data: []},
+ { title: "绂佺敤鐘舵��", field: "enableStatus", type: "select", data: [], dataKey:"status" },
+ ],
+ [
+
+ { title: "琛�", field: "row", type: "int" },
+ { title: "鍒�", field: "column", type: "int" },
+ { title: "灞�", field: "layer", type: "int" }
],
]);
const columns = ref([
{
field: "id",
- title: "Id",
+ title: "涓婚敭",
type: "int",
- width: 100,
+ width: 90,
hidden: true,
readonly: true,
require: true,
align: "left",
},
// {
- // field: "areaId",
- // title: "鍖哄煙涓婚敭",
- // type: "string",
- // width: 90,
+ // field: "warehouseId",
+ // title: "搴撴埧缂栧彿",
+ // type: "select",
+ // width: 120,
// align: "left",
- // bind: {key: "areainfo",data: []}
+ // data: [],
+ // bind: { key: "warehouses", data: [] }
// },
+ {
+ field: "warehouseCode",
+ title: "搴撴埧缂栧彿",
+ type: "select",
+ width: 120,
+ align: "left",
+ data: [],
+ bind: { key: "warehouseNuber", data: [] }
+ },
{
field: "locationCode",
title: "璐т綅缂栧彿",
type: "string",
- width: 200,
+ width: 120,
align: "left",
},
{
field: "locationName",
title: "璐т綅鍚嶇О",
type: "string",
- width: 280,
+ width: 150,
align: "left",
},
{
field: "roadwayNo",
title: "宸烽亾缂栧彿",
- type: "decimal",
+ type: "string",
width: 100,
align: "left",
},
{
field: "row",
title: "璐т綅琛�",
- type: "string",
- width: 90,
+ type: "int",
+ width: 80,
align: "left",
- hidden: true,
},
{
field: "column",
title: "璐т綅鍒�",
type: "int",
- width: 120,
+ width: 80,
align: "left",
- hidden: true,
},
{
field: "layer",
title: "璐т綅灞�",
- type: "string",
- width: 200,
+ type: "int",
+ width: 80,
align: "left",
- hidden: true,
},
{
field: "depth",
title: "璐т綅娣卞害",
- type: "string",
- width: 180,
+ type: "int",
+ width: 100,
align: "left",
- hidden: true,
},
- {
- field: "locationType",
- title: "璐т綅绫诲瀷",
- type: "string",
- width: 120,
- align: "left",
- bind:{key: "locationTypeEnum", data: []}
- },
+ // {
+ // field: "locationType",
+ // title: "璐т綅绫诲瀷",
+ // type: "select",
+ // width: 120,
+ // align: "left",
+ // data: [],
+ // bind: { key: "locationTypeEnum", data: [] }
+ // },
{
field: "locationStatus",
title: "璐т綅鐘舵��",
- type: "string",
+ type: "select",
width: 120,
align: "left",
+ data: [],
bind: { key: "locationStatusEnum", data: [] },
},
{
field: "enableStatus",
title: "绂佺敤鐘舵��",
- type: "string",
- width: 80,
+ type: "select",
+ width: 100,
align: "left",
+ data: [],
bind: { key: "status", data: [] },
},
+ // {
+ // field: "remark",
+ // title: "澶囨敞",
+ // type: "string",
+ // width: 150,
+ // align: "left",
+ // },
{
field: "creater",
title: "鍒涘缓浜�",
type: "string",
- width: 90,
+ width: 100,
align: "left",
- hidden: true,
},
{
field: "createDate",
@@ -169,7 +305,6 @@
width: 160,
align: "left",
sort: true,
- hidden: true,
},
{
field: "modifier",
@@ -185,15 +320,7 @@
width: 160,
align: "left",
sort: true,
- },
- {
- field: "remark",
- title: "澶囨敞",
- type: "string",
- width: 100,
- align: "left",
- hidden: true
- },
+ }
]);
const detail = ref({
cnName: "#detailCnName",
@@ -213,5 +340,4 @@
};
},
});
-</script>
-
\ No newline at end of file
+</script>
\ No newline at end of file
--
Gitblit v1.9.3